Floyd Residential Internet Coverage
The remote town of Floyd is one of the smallest in Iowa, although it is located along one of Iowa's largest state highways. With just over 300 residents, Floyd is a tight-knit community with a handful of shops and amenities for residents. Whether you live in this area or own a business in Floyd, you can use high speed Internet to stay connected.
One of the most flexible providers in Floyd is OmniTel Communications, a local provider that supplies cable, DSL, and fiber to the entire city of Floyd. This provider has several download speed options to accommodate all different usage habits and budgets.
DSL is available through other sources as well. CenturyLink has an established network in this region, as does Windstream. Those considering cable for their Floyd home or business can look into service options through Mediacom. Mediacom download speeds are fairly similar to those available through CenturyLink.
